How is the high crime rate impacting residents in Glapwell?

Quick Answer

Glapwell's crime rate is 37.9 per 1,000 residents, significantly lower than the UK average of 91.6. Despite this, residents should remain aware and contribute to maintaining the area’s high safety score of 91/100.
